Transaction e41dc80714e5243fe7849b235626b3d983032a4d11f1c05d3423a06303a37a2a
2 Input
2 Outputs
- e41dc80714e5243fe7849b235626b3d983032a4d11f1c05d3423a06303a37a2a:0
- e41dc80714e5243fe7849b235626b3d983032a4d11f1c05d3423a06303a37a2a:1
value 50000000
address 1Nwv4HnRazLkvbbBtpxBd73bVZML8tDq8P
value 639742
address 1CjrfxSke9Ftk8aAdSWoZASUjZJy9GUcMh